Converge ICT’s prepaid broadband brand, Surf2Sawa (S2S), has hit 500,000 active subscribers two years post-launch, highlighting a significant shift in the Philippine internet market toward flexible, budget-conscious connectivity solutions. This reflects changing consumer behavior, as affordability and on-demand access increasingly drive broadband adoption.

The Philippine government posted a budget deficit of P869.2 billion at the end of August, around 56 percent of the revised full-year target of P1.56 trillion for 2025.
